GD 414 — Graphic Design for Packaging
2 credits; 1 lecture and 2 lab hours
Application of images and type to packaging design is studied. Various types of packaging, printing, and fabrication methods, as well as regulatory guidelines, are explored.
Prerequisite(s): GD 345.
Graphic Design BFA Degree Program

School of Art and Design Applications accepted for fall only. NYSED: 24515 CIP: 50.0409 The major in Graphic Design requires students to hone a personal voice based on critical thinking, social awareness, and the ability to communicate across an array of platforms utilizing the full range of media, from the tactile to advanced digital technology. Topics of study include editorial design, interactive web design, and experiential design (exhibitions and wayfinding), along with advanced typography, branding, motion graphics, and new design approaches and practices. An internship is required and often leads to sustained positions in the vast field of multidisciplinary design. Curriculum below is for the entering class of fall 2025.
